OK Friends Sekedar Info menurut pengalaman saya dalam developt perangkat lunak, di beberapa Hospital yg punya database "GEDE BUANGET and very complicated" kita sarankan dan pernah dijalankan , memang ada kreteria "Policy" masing masing ada yang boleh diupdate sendiri ( Click Update ) berisi prosedur hitung ulang ada yang otomatic , disana kita jalankan via menu UPDATE DATA BULANAN" yang mencakup seluruh system aplikasi yang ada dan dijalankan oleh UNIT E.D.P / I.T So , tergantung kita dan Pimpinan ...lah...!!!
On 11/11/05, [EMAIL PROTECTED] <[EMAIL PROTECTED]> wrote: > > ya pak proses posting cuman untuk menyalin semua transaksi ke tblkartustok > yang di dalamnya ada field KodeBarang, Pembelian, dst (nama transaksinya) > sehingga kalo reporting masalah transaksi saya tinggal meng' query > tblStokBarang itu aja, kalo pindah MySQL saya pinginnya emang memanfaatkan > SP ama view (kalo ini di access pun sudah pak) tapi sekarang MySQL nya > bilang juga belum stabil jadi nunggu sampe lumayan stabil ..... wah ini udah > di gratisin rewel lagi ya pak hehehehe > > > thx > > ----- Original Message ----- > From: Ronald Irawan > To: [email protected] > Sent: Friday, November 11, 2005 1:57 PM > Subject: Re: [indoprog-vb] Inventory System > > > Berarti posting itu untuk memporses tblkartu stock ( insert/update/delete) > > ? yg "CUma" digunakan untuk reporting ? > kalau menurut saya untuk report lebih baik pake SP atau View... lebih up > to date datanya, apalagi anda rencananya mau pake Mysql, kan disana sudah > ada view / sp, manfaatkan lah mereka.... > Kalau transaksi makin besar, tidak selamanya mengakibatkan query lambat, > kalau query sudah terasa lambat coba anda tuning database anda, entah itu > di kasih index, atau dst dst.... > Cuma pendapat saya saja... > > Salam > Ronald Irawan > Pt. Sanghiang Perkasa > Gd. Graha Kirana Lt.5 > Jl Yos Sudarso Kav.88 > Jakarta > > > > <[EMAIL PROTECTED]> > Sent by: [email protected] > 11/11/2005 01:39 PM > Please respond to > [email protected] > > > To > <[email protected]> > cc > > Subject > Re: [indoprog-vb] Inventory System > > > > > > > wah jujur senang sekali saya ama mailing list ini, bisa belajar banyak hal > > baru :D > untuk proses posting yang bertujuan untuk menyatukan proses transaksi ke > satu table ini saya maksudkan agar dalam proses pelaporan nanti juga bisa > ketahuan barang masuknya berapa, yang keluar berapa, yang rusak berapa, > meskipun hal ini bisa dilakukan dengan query, tapi menurut pengalaman saya > > kalo transaksi udah besar jadi lambat sekali proses querynya jadi saya > putuskan saya jadikan satu aja ke satu table sehingga proses query hanya > berjalan satu kali terhadap tblKartuStok itu aja dan untuk menjaga > integritas data makanya saya beri tanda bahwa kalo yang sudah terposting > tidak bisa dirubah lagi sehingga hal ini bisa menjamin bahwa transaksi > yang ada antara table realnya dan tblKartuStok bisa sama persis.... apakah > > ini juga termasuk unnormalisasi ? :) > > mohon sharing dari teman-teman.... > > thx > bartolomeus edi susanto > ----- Original Message ----- > From: Masino Sinaga > To: [email protected] > Sent: Friday, November 11, 2005 1:24 PM > Subject: Re: [indoprog-vb] Inventory System > > > Waduh, kalau pertanyaan seperti ini saya tidak bisa menentukan apakah > kondisi saat ini yg terbaik atau tidak, karena itu lebih bersifat kepada > > kebutuhan atau spec sistem secara keseluruhan di tempat Anda. Kalau > menurut > Anda harus posting dulu baru saldo berubah, silahkan... tapi kalau nggak > > gitu, juga silahkan. Di sinilah berperan proses bisnis yang harus > ditentukan sebelum pengembangan suatu aplikasi. Kalau bicara tentang > "efektif", jelas menggunakan Trigger lebih efektif, karena tidak perlu > harus melalui posting dari client seperti yg Anda maksud. > > Tapi, kalau boleh saya beri saran... agar aplikasi Anda lebih fleksibel, > > sebaiknya di aplikasi tetap bisa mengakomodir kedua kondisi tersebut. > Anda > bisa siasati misalnya dengan cara membuat suatu menu setting yang bisa > "menukar" dari kondisi satu (harus posting dulu; tidak pakai Trigger) ke > > kondisi kedua (tidak perlu harus posting dulu; tapi menggunakan > Trigger), > dan sebaliknya. Mengenai siapa yang berhak menentukan pilihan ini, > silahkan > Anda level "Manager" dari aplikasi tsb, apakah setting tsb hanya bisa > diganti oleh Administrator atau Manajer saja, atau Administrator dan > Manajer (asalkan jangan user/operatornya, bisa bahaya nanti kalau setiap > > orang bisa mengganti-ganti setting ini... hehehehe...). Good luck. > > Masino Sinaga > > At 12:55 11/11/2005, you wrote: > >makasih pak atas replynya, untuk MySQL 5 juga udah download yang 5.015 > >tapi baru coba2 untuk viewnya (sayangnya harus tulis syntax ngga kaya > >Access untuk bikin querynya hehehe kan bisa lebih cepet) dan alasan > saya > >pindah ke MySQL karena gratis dan udah dukung SP cuman juga masih pake > >ODBC, ada sih API untuk connectornya tapi masih belum stabil katanya > jadi > >sekarang masih pake access hehehe, tapi pak masino untuk sistem yang > saya > >terapkan itu menurut bapak bagaimana ? apakah udah efektif dengan jalan > > >harus Posting dulu gitu.... (emang bisa sih posting otomatis cuman ini > >usernya minta manual aja biar yakin dulu baru di posting). bagaimana > pak ? > > > >thx > > ----- Original Message ----- > > From: Masino Sinaga > > To: [email protected] > > Sent: Friday, November 11, 2005 12:31 PM > > Subject: Re: [indoprog-vb] Inventory System > > > > > > Mhs, jika Anda sepenuhnya sudah beralih ke MySQL 5, masalah pertama > pasti > > bisa diatasi. Bukankah di MySQL 5 sudah ada Trigger seperti di SQL > Server > > yang bisa Anda set di database-nya...? Jadi, setiap ada transaksi yg > > terkait dgn Saldo di database, trigger akan dijalankan dan otomatis > Saldo > > menjadi posisi terakhir walaupun user/client Anda belum melakukan > posting. > > Sayangnya, saya belum sempat nyoba MySQL 5 padahal download > installer-nya > > sudah beberapa hari yg lalu, hiks. :( > > > > Kalau memang karena perbedaan tipe field itu penyebabnya, sebaiknya > > gunakan > > tipe data yang sama di field2 terkait yaitu Long Integer. Jangan > lupa baca > > manual MySQL tentang type data... :p Semoga berhasil. > > > > Masino Sinaga > > > > At 11:31 11/11/2005, you wrote: > > >Saya baru mengembangkan inventory sistem, tetapi ada yang jadi > > >ganjalan buat saya masalah sistem nya sendiri : > > >1. Katakan di sistem itu ada Stok Opname, Penerimaan, Penjualan, > > >Komplimen, Rusak terus untuk pengupdate an saldo akhir yang > terletak > > >di master barang saya langsung mengupdatenya setiap ada transaksi > > >entah itu penerimaan, penjualan, dll, jadi setiap save di dalamnya > ada > > >prosedur UPDATE tblMasterBarang SET StokAkhir = StokAkhir - Rusak > > >WHERE KodeBarang = blabla (kalo ada rusak), cuman untuk > pelaporannya > > >saya menggunakan Posting, jadi saya buat satu form posting dan di > > >dalamnya ada prosedur memindahkan semua transaksi apapun ke dalam > > >table tblKartuStok sehingga waktu saya mau buat pelaporan stok, > saya > > >tinggal query bulan yang dibutuhkan dari kartu stok itu dan di > combine > > >Saldo Awal dari transaksi Stok Opname (saya menganggap stok opname > > >yang valid bukan perhitungan saldo dari komputer). So selama sang > user > > >belum posting maka pelaporan stok belum ter uptodate, memang saya > liat > > >belum ada masalahnya, masalahnya sering kali membingungkan para > user > > >bahwa kalo mereka belum posting maka saldo akhir yang di master > barang > > >dan di pelaporan sering selisih tapi setelah posting maka baru ngga > > >selisih karena semua transaksinya udah masuk di tblKartuStok dan > semua > > >transaksi saya kasi kolom Posting yang saya isi dengan angka 1 kalo > > >sudah terposting dan 0 kalo yang belum, dan kalo sudah di posting > > >transaksi yang bersangkutan tidak bisa diedit lagi untuk menjaga > > >integritas data. > > > > > >2. Untuk type data saya buat untuk harga pake Currency dan Qty pake > > >Long Integer, apakah ini sudah benar ato harga saya pape Long > Integer > > >aja, selama ini emang ngga masalah tapi jadi 'ganjalan' juga buat > saya > > > karena beberapa kali transaksi bila di query dalam jumlah besar > hasil > > >SUM dari qty*harga sering jadi masalah (tidak cocok). > > > > > >Backend saya pake MS ACCESS ini baru mau pindah ke MySQL karena > udah > > >ada View dan SP nya.... > > > > > >kalo menurut teman2 cara yang lebih efektif dan tepat untuk > menangani > > >ke dua hal itu apa ya ? > > >tolong pencerahannya... > > > > > >thx > > >edi susanto > > > > Untuk berhenti berlangganan kirim email kosong ke : > [EMAIL PROTECTED] > > Ikuti juga forum diskusi VB.net dengan > mengirim email kosong ke [EMAIL PROTECTED] > > > > > SPONSORED LINKS Computer internet security Computer internet business > Computer internet access > Computer internet privacy securities Computer internet help > Computer internet connection > > > > ------------------------------------------------------------------------------ > YAHOO! GROUPS LINKS > > a.. Visit your group "indoprog-vb" on the web. > > b.. To unsubscribe from this group, send an email to: > [EMAIL PROTECTED] > > c.. Your use of Yahoo! Groups is subject to the Yahoo! Terms of > Service. > > > > ------------------------------------------------------------------------------ > > > > [Non-text portions of this message have been removed] > > > > > Untuk berhenti berlangganan kirim email kosong ke : > [EMAIL PROTECTED] > > Ikuti juga forum diskusi VB.net dengan > mengirim email kosong ke [EMAIL PROTECTED] > > Yahoo! Groups Links > > > > > > > > > > [Non-text portions of this message have been removed] > > > > Untuk berhenti berlangganan kirim email kosong ke : > [EMAIL PROTECTED] > > Ikuti juga forum diskusi VB.net dengan > mengirim email kosong ke [EMAIL PROTECTED] > > > > > SPONSORED LINKS Computer internet security Computer internet business > Computer internet access > Computer internet privacy securities Computer internet help Computer > internet connection > > > > ------------------------------------------------------------------------------ > YAHOO! GROUPS LINKS > > a.. Visit your group "indoprog-vb" on the web. > > b.. To unsubscribe from this group, send an email to: > [EMAIL PROTECTED] > > c.. Your use of Yahoo! Groups is subject to the Yahoo! Terms of Service. > > > > ------------------------------------------------------------------------------ > > > > [Non-text portions of this message have been removed] > > > > Untuk berhenti berlangganan kirim email kosong ke : > [EMAIL PROTECTED] > > Ikuti juga forum diskusi VB.net dengan > mengirim email kosong ke [EMAIL PROTECTED] > > > > ------------------------------ > YAHOO! GROUPS LINKS > > > - Visit your group "indoprog-vb<http://groups.yahoo.com/group/indoprog-vb>" > on the web. > - To unsubscribe from this group, send an email to: > [EMAIL PROTECTED]<[EMAIL PROTECTED]> > - Your use of Yahoo! Groups is subject to the Yahoo! Terms of > Service <http://docs.yahoo.com/info/terms/>. > > > ------------------------------ > -- Senior Instruktur / Programmer Irazedia Computer and Business Center Jalan Raya Galaxy Blok A No; 28 Kalimalang - Bekasi Selatan [Non-text portions of this message have been removed] ------------------------ Yahoo! Groups Sponsor --------------------~--> Get Bzzzy! (real tools to help you find a job). Welcome to the Sweet Life. http://us.click.yahoo.com/A77XvD/vlQLAA/TtwFAA/zCsqlB/TM --------------------------------------------------------------------~-> Untuk berhenti berlangganan kirim email kosong ke : [EMAIL PROTECTED] Ikuti juga forum diskusi VB.net dengan mengirim email kosong ke [EMAIL PROTECTED] Yahoo! Groups Links <*> To visit your group on the web, go to: http://groups.yahoo.com/group/indoprog-vb/ <*> To unsubscribe from this group, send an email to: [EMAIL PROTECTED] <*> Your use of Yahoo! Groups is subject to: http://docs.yahoo.com/info/terms/
